In the first edition, quivering palms was restricted to on time per week, and targets who ain't immune to crit. hits (like golems and other constructs)and don't have mor hit dices then the level of the monk.

In the second edition, this was further restricted to human-sized enemys.

Eigther way, it shouldn't work on a dragon. Well, perhaps on the little fairy dragon your mage plays around with
